Find

Синтаксис

Find(Find_text, Within_text[, Start_num])

Параметры

Find_text. Подстрока, которую необходимо найти в исходной строке;

Within_text. Исходная строка, по которой осуществляется поиск;

Start_num. Необязательный параметр. Позиция элемента исходной строки, с которой осуществляется поиск. Если он не задан, поиск подстроки в исходной строке будет осуществляться с начала исходной строки.

Примечание. В качестве параметра можно указывать как непосредственно значение параметра, так и адрес ячейки, в которой оно располагается.

Описание

Возвращает позицию одной строки в другой.

Комментарии

Поиск осуществляется, начиная с указанного элемента исходной строки с учетом регистра. Если исходной строки нет в искомой, функция возвращает «#ЗНАЧ». Нумерация элементов в исходной строке начинается с 1.

Пример

Формула Результат Описание
=Find("b", "BcBcab") 6 Возвращает индекс первого вхождения строки b в исходную строку BcBcab, начиная с первого элемента исходной строки.
=Find("b", "zzzzZ") #ЗНАЧ В исходной строке zzzzZ не найдена подстрока b.
=Find(B6, C6, E6) 5 Возвращает индекс первого вхождения строки в ячейке B6 в исходную строку C6, начиная с элемента исходной строки, номер которого расположен в ячейке E6. Ячейка B6 содержит значение A, C6 - AcbaA, E6 содержит число 2.

См. также:

Мастер функцийТекстовые функцииExact